Forum » Programiranje » En problem v ASP
En problem v ASP
teac ::
V MS Accessu si naredim tabelo. Potem naredim iz te tabele formo. To formo shranim in jo pote izvozim, kot MICROSOFT ACTIVE SERVER PAGES (ASP). Zdaj pa me zanima, kaj naj napišem v tisti okno, kjer mi napiše, da morem vpisat IME VIRA PODATKOV? Zdaj sem vpisal ASPDeveloper, vendar mi potem ko sem hotel dostopat do tega *.asp fajla na mojem strežniku ni delovalo. Napako mi je javlo prav v tej vrstici...
conn.open "ASPDeveloper","username","password"
Kaj morem tam vpisat, da bo to delovalo?
conn.open "ASPDeveloper","username","password"
Kaj morem tam vpisat, da bo to delovalo?
- spremenilo: teac ()
teac ::
No ja, mogoče v zgornjem postu nisem najboljše opisal, kaj v resnici rabim (pač, prišel sem domov in se vsedel za računalnik).
Tu pa je še error, ki mi ga vrže:
Technical Information (for support personnel)
Error Type:
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ified
/test.asp, line 12
Ta test.asp pa je moja forma, ki sem si jo naredil v accessu.
Tu pa je še error, ki mi ga vrže:
Technical Information (for support personnel)
Error Type:
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)
[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ified
/test.asp, line 12
Ta test.asp pa je moja forma, ki sem si jo naredil v accessu.
Loki ::
sklepam, da si nastavil DSN baze na nadzorni plosci/ administrative tools/ data sources (ODBC).
teac ::
Ja, sem si. Saj misliš SYSTEM DNS, a ne? Sem si nastavil oz. inštaliral (Microsoft Access Driver (*.mdb))
Zgodovina sprememb…
- spremenilo: teac ()
david ::
napako imas prif konfiguriranju baze, se pravi systemDNSa ... meni se je to velikokrat dogajalo in se danes ne vem, kaj je napaka ;) ti pa svetujem nekaj drugega:
strconn =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=c:\pot\do\baze.mdb"
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open strconn
pac vkljucis tja, kjer bazo potrebujes ... najbolje, da to kontroliras preko INCLUDE stavka ...
david ...
strconn =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source=c:\pot\do\baze.mdb"
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open strconn
pac vkljucis tja, kjer bazo potrebujes ... najbolje, da to kontroliras preko INCLUDE stavka ...
david ...
webblod ::
Se popolnoma strinjam z davidko... Nikar ne dostopaj iz ASP preko DSN-ja, vedno neposredno iz kode (razlika v hitrosti je več kot očitna), sicer pa morda še en namig...
tisti conn.open bi jaz izpustil in ga vstavil natanko tja kjer ga potrebujem... Pri delu z IIS-om je namreč potrebno izredno pazljivo delati z resource-i in odprta povezava jih porabi mnogo... Če ne verjameš probaj z dvema gumboma (conn.open in conn.close) in v task manager-ju poglej, kaj se dogaja...
tisti conn.open bi jaz izpustil in ga vstavil natanko tja kjer ga potrebujem... Pri delu z IIS-om je namreč potrebno izredno pazljivo delati z resource-i in odprta povezava jih porabi mnogo... Če ne verjameš probaj z dvema gumboma (conn.open in conn.close) in v task manager-ju poglej, kaj se dogaja...
There must be a reason, why I'm so damn dissapointed on M$ Visual Basic
WEBblod.NET :: Slovenska programerska scena
WEBblod.NET :: Slovenska programerska scena
Vredno ogleda ...
Tema | Ogledi | Zadnje sporočilo | |
---|---|---|---|
Tema | Ogledi | Zadnje sporočilo | |
» | [c#] in sql bazaOddelek: Programiranje | 1368 (867) | japol |
» | [C#] Spremembe podatkov se ne shranijo v podatkovno bazoOddelek: Programiranje | 1609 (1200) | somebody16 |
» | [ASP.NET] label povezava z bazoOddelek: Programiranje | 1108 (1024) | darkolord |
» | ASP in vnosni podatki v MDBOddelek: Izdelava spletišč | 990 (901) | swalow |
» | Visual Basic Developer Site & ForumOddelek: Programiranje | 1898 (1489) | webblod |